Waba Grill Store locator Glendale

Waba Grill stores located in Glendale: 1
Largest shopping mall with Waba Grill store in Glendale: Glendale Galleria 

Waba Grill store locator Glendale displays complete list and huge database of Waba Grill stores, factory stores, shops and boutiques in Glendale (California). Waba Grill information: map of Glendale, shopping hours, contact information.

Waba Grill stores in Glendale, California on Map

Waba Grill stores in Glendale, California on Map

Waba Grill store locations in Glendale (California)

More Waba Grill stores in California - CA

Search all Waba Grill stores located in Glendale, California

Specify Waba Grill store location:

Go to the city Waba Grill locator